The ingredients needed to make Crockpot Red beans and rice:
  1. Prepare 1 14oz pack of smoked sausage
  2. Take 3 can kidney beans
  3. Take 2 tbsp pig butter (bacon grease)
  4. Get 1 green bell pepper
  5. Get 6 cup chicken broth
  6. Get 1 tbsp Cajun seasoning (I buy in bulk at natural food store you can use whatever brand you want)
  7. Make ready 1 tbsp granulated garlic
  8. Prepare 1/2 tsp celery seed
  9. Take salt
  10. Prepare pepper
  11. Make ready 4 cup rice (2 cups uncooked as rice doubles in size when cooking)
Steps to make Crockpot Red beans and rice:
  1. Chop up peppers and sauage
  2. Fry up the peppers and sausage in the bacon fat (feel free to use whatever you want to fry it in for you health nuts but I like the flavor it gives) if not using bacon grease add dash of salt.
  3. Rinse canned beans and add to crock pot
  4. Add all the spices to the pot and mix in the chicken broth
  5. Add sautéed peppers and sausage when the sausage is good and browned.
  6. Let cook on low for 6-8 hours
  7. Pour over rice and enjoy
